- [ ] **Step 7: Breaker override escrow.** After sealing the signing keys for the Tallgrove upstream API circuit breaker, confirm the support team can force the breaker open during a full outage. The override bundle lives in the sealed escrow drawer and is useless without its unlock phrase. Two ceremony witnesses must initial this step before proceeding. The escrow bundle is decrypted with the recovery passphrase that follows.

vault phrase of kahip-kahop = holath-quenmir

**Release checklist — Crashlight pipeline (Marbleton app v4.2)**

Verify that the crash-report pipeline correctly symbolicates reports from both staging and production flavors before sign-off. Reviewer should confirm the ingestion worker drops duplicate reports within the five-minute dedup window and that retention is set to ninety days, per the Harrowgate compliance memo. Run the smoke suite against the candidate artifact and confirm all twelve checks pass. The candidate build identifier is listed below.

session token of tajog-fahaf = htk21_4ae55819f45410afcb307

Deploy step 4, Hallways audio-guide app (Ostrander Museum build). Pull the release tag, run migrations, restart the stream worker. Confirm GUIDE_CDN_REGION matches the venue. Playback fails silently if the audio vault token is missing, so check it first. Open the production env file and add the token on the next line.

env line for fafof-fahag: LEDGER_TOKEN5=f8790

Welcome aboard! During your first week at Brindlemoor Labs you'll likely host a contractor or two from the Ostrave refit crew. Quick rules: sign them in at the atrium desk, stay with them in any workspace, and don't let them wander past the blue line on Level 3. They can use the kitchenette, not the server corridor. To let yourself and your guest through the east wing doors, use the pass below.

staff pass of kawip-hawef = bdg-QLP-2